Contenu | Rechercher | Menus

Annonce

DVD, clés USB et t-shirts Ubuntu-fr disponibles sur la boutique En Vente Libre

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 01/11/2022, à 11:10

Tchae7

Installation double boot sur SSD vierge

Bonjour,

Suite à qq problèmes j'ai effectué une mise à jour matérielle de mon Lenovo B70 : 8go de ram et un nouveau SSD de 1To.

Je souhaite maintenant installer Unbuntu 22.04 en double boot avec Windows 10;
Je vais donc installer une nouvelle version de windows sur ce disque.

Je souhaite partitionner le disque de façon à ce que les deux systèmes soient indépendants de leurs données et que,
dans la mesure du possible, chacun des systèmes puissent accéder aux deux disques de données.

Je me pose les questions suivantes :

1) Vaut il mieux commencer par installer windows ou Unbuntu ?

2) Dois je partitionner le disque avant de commencer l'opération avec GParted ?
Je pensais effectuer 4 partitions : 100Go, 300Go, 100Go et 400Go (approximativement)
pour Ubuntu / données Ubuntu / windows / Données windows
Ou bien est ce que les partitions du disque dur s'effectuent plus simplement au moment des installations des systèmes ?

3) S'il est pertinent de partitionner ainsi avec GParted faut il utiliser des partitions primaires/étendues/logiques et quel
système de fichiers faut il utiliser : ext4 ?

4) Dans l'optique d'avoir les données Ubuntu sur une partition séparée faudra t il demander de placer /home sur l'autre partition et dans l'affirmative à quel moment de l'installation ?

5) A quel moment dois-je installer Grub ?


Merci d'avance pour vos conseils.

Hors ligne

#2 Le 01/11/2022, à 12:38

malbo

Re : Installation double boot sur SSD vierge

Tchae7 a écrit :

Je souhaite partitionner le disque de façon à ce que les deux systèmes soient indépendants de leurs données et que,
dans la mesure du possible, chacun des systèmes puissent accéder aux deux disques de données.

Bonjour,
Comme tu ne souhaites pas cloisonner entre les deux systèmes, la configuration généralement adoptée c'est une seule partition de données commune aux deux systèmes comme présenté dans le paragraphe 3.1 Partition de données indépendante du système d'exploitation de la doc "Installation d'Ubuntu : partitionnement manuel". Pour le type de partition, le paragraphe indique : "pour partager des données avec Windows choisissez une partition de partage de type NTFS"

EDIT : je te suggère de faire l'installation de Windows 10 en premier en le laissant installer sur la totalité du SSD. La création de la table de partitions et des partitions nécessaires à Win10 sera faite automatiquement.
Après vérification que Win10 fonctionne bien, tu pourras faire la modification du partitionnement en suivant les indications de la doc "Comment installer Ubuntu en cohabitation (double amorçage) avec Windows", puis faire l'installation avec le choix "Autre chose" quand tu seras à l'étape "Type d'installation". Les partitions à créer seront :
- une partition racine de 40 Go pour la racine de Ubuntu (format EXT4)
- une partition NTFS destinée à devenir la partition de stockage commune à Win10 et Ubuntu
Aucune autre partition n'est utile à créer (pas de partition SWAP)

Dernière modification par malbo (Le 01/11/2022, à 12:56)

Hors ligne

#3 Le 01/11/2022, à 13:13

geole

Re : Installation double boot sur SSD vierge

Bonjour
Le plus pratique est de commencer par  lancer gparted et de créer une table de partition GPT.
Puis de lancer windows en demandant une   installation personnalisée dans un espace de 100 Go.
  Il fera cela
    Constat que la partition dispose d'une table de partition GPT.    Donc 
    Création d'une partition de 128 Mo avec flag MFSRES
    Création d'une partition de 511 Mo  en FAT32 avec flag ESP
    Création d'une partition de presque  100 Go pour y mettre son logiciel et ses données.
Puis de lancer plusieurs fois windows pour qu'il finisse toutes ses mises à jour.
Pendant un de ces lancements, tu vas créer la partition de données.  Soit au format NTFS soit au format EXFAT  d'une taille de 700 GO avec une étiquette/label Commun
Puis tu installes ubuntu en choisissant  l'option "autre chose".
   Tu alloues l'espace disque restant  (100 Go) au format EXT4  au point de montage /
  Tu alloues la grosse partition Commun au point de montage /media/Commun
Puis tu finis  l'installation de ubuntu.  il mettra automatiquement le logiciel grub dans la partition EFI
Il te restera à rebooter et à traiter les liens symboliques pour partition commune
La partition est déjà montée et le document  explique aussi comment  s'occuper de windows

Nota:  Avoir une seule partition de données, supprime le calcul de la taille exacte des deux partitions.   D'ailleurs on se trompe toujours. il y en a une de pleine alors que l'autre ne l'est qu'à moitié.
Peut-être que 50 Go pour ubuntu est suffisant si tu ne  n'utilise pas trop.
Avoir une partition home  sur le même disque est source de complications et n'apporte strictement rien.

Dernière modification par geole (Le 01/11/2022, à 13:32)

Hors ligne

#4 Le 04/11/2022, à 19:23

Tchae7

Re : Installation double boot sur SSD vierge

Merci beaucoup pour vos réponses,

J'ai donc commencé par créer une table de partition avec GParted puis j'ai installé windows sur une partition de 100Go qu'il a créé lors de l'installation.

Jusque là tout va bien.
Maintenant je galère pour "arrêter" windows, d'après ce que j'ai lu arrêter n'arrête pas windows et effectivement il ne veut plus démarrer depuis le live usb ubuntu 22.04 (alors que le bios est réglé pour booter sur la clef usb)


D'autre part je voudrais être sûr de bien comprendre : j'étais parti dans l'idée de deux partitions systèmes windows et linux et de deux partitions de données (une pour chaque système).
Vous me conseillez plutôt de n'avoir qu'une partition de données commune aux deux systèmes, c'est bien ça ?

D'autre part si /home n'est pas sur une partition séparée du système linux il y a des données qui vont rester sur le disque système, non ?
Comme téléchargements par exemple...

(Désolé pour le manque de réactivité, je suis en déplacement...)

Hors ligne

#5 Le 04/11/2022, à 23:14

geole

Re : Installation double boot sur SSD vierge

Bonsoir.
Lorsque windows est installé, il ne faut plus lancer windows depuis le live-usb mais depuis le ssd .
interne.
Tu as dit "chacun des systèmes puissent accéder aux deux disques de données."
Comme windows n'accède pas facilement aux partitions EXT4, il faudrait créer deux partitions NTFS
Je ne vois pas un seul argument le justifiant. Il est nettement plus simple d'en avoir une seule à gérer.

Tu ne mettras aucune donnée personnelle dans le home puisque tu diras qu'il faut les réexpédier dans la partition NTFS. il ne restera que le logiciel du home.
Schéma de principe aussi valable pour téléchargements
http://mezigoo.free.fr/ps/ps2/11.png

Dernière modification par geole (Le 04/11/2022, à 23:20)

Hors ligne

#6 Le 05/11/2022, à 09:04

Tchae7

Re : Installation double boot sur SSD vierge

Ok pour l'unique partition de données.

Mais je ne comprends pas la phrase :
"Lorsque windows est installé, il ne faut plus lancer windows depuis le live-usb mais depuis le ssd interne."

Windows se lance bien depuis le ssd mais maintenant je voudrais installer linux, or pour cela dans ce tutoriel il est dit qu'il faut redémarrer depuis le live CD ubuntu pour accéder à GParted afin de faire de la place pour Ubuntu.

Et puis ici il est écrit qu'il faut effectuer un arrêt total de windows.
Pour l'instant je n'ai pas réussi ces étapes. (est ce que le boot doit être en UEFI ou en Legacy Support ?)


EDIT : j'ai créé ma clef live USB avec Rufus en mode iso, faut-il réessayer en mode DD ?

Dernière modification par Tchae7 (Le 05/11/2022, à 09:42)

Hors ligne

#7 Le 05/11/2022, à 10:34

geole

Re : Installation double boot sur SSD vierge

Bonjour
En premier, je répondais à ta question "Maintenant je galère pour "arrêter" windows, d'après ce que j'ai lu arrêter n'arrête pas windows et effectivement il ne veut plus démarrer depuis le live usb ubuntu 22.04 "

En second, Il semble que tu n'as pas installé windows sur la totalité du disque donc la place existe déjà.

En trois, un arrêt  de windows consiste à sélectionner l'option redémarer Cependant l'option Arrêter est utilisable à condition que tu aies déactivé l'hibernation avec la commande powercfg hibernate /off

En quatre. La commande dd n'existe pas sous windows. Certains préfèrent l'application ventoy
Je doute que le mode ISO soit bon pour un ordinateur uniquement EFI.

Dernière modification par geole (Le 05/11/2022, à 10:50)

Hors ligne

#8 Le 05/11/2022, à 10:37

malbo

Re : Installation double boot sur SSD vierge

Tchae7 a écrit :

Et puis ici il est écrit qu'il faut effectuer un arrêt total de windows.
Pour l'instant je n'ai pas réussi ces étapes. (est ce que le boot doit être en UEFI ou en Legacy Support ?)

La fonctionnalité qui pose problème s'appelle la "veille prolongée". Je te suggère d'appliquer ce qui est détaillé au paragraphe "Comment rendre la mise en veille prolongée indisponible" de cette page : https://learn.microsoft.com/fr-fr/troub … ibernation

Hors ligne

#9 Le 05/11/2022, à 11:10

Tchae7

Re : Installation double boot sur SSD vierge

Merci,

@geole : je comprends le malentendu; dans ma phrase : "...et effectivement il ne veut plus démarrer depuis le live usb ubuntu 22.04 "
le 'il' désiganit l'ordinateur, pas windows, c'était mal formulé, désolé.

@malbo : merci, désactiver la veille prolongée de windows, m'a permis de repartir de la clef live usb (j'ai l'impression que le lien correspondant dans le tutoriel ne renvoie pas à la page pertinente que tu m'as envoyée).

Dernière modification par Tchae7 (Le 05/11/2022, à 11:10)

Hors ligne

#10 Le 05/11/2022, à 11:21

geole

Re : Installation double boot sur SSD vierge

Le lien de malbo dit

https://learn.microsoft.com/fr-fr/troubleshoot/windows-client/deployment/disable-and-re-enable-hibernation a écrit :

Comment rendre la mise en veille prolongée indisponible

Appuyez sur Windows sur le clavier pour ouvrir le menu Démarrer ou l’écran de démarrage.
Recherchez cmd. Dans la liste des résultats de la recherche, cliquez avec le bouton droit sur Invite de commandes, puis cliquez sur Exécuter en tant qu’administrateur.
Dans l’invite du contrôle de compte d’utilisateur, cliquez sur Continuer.
Dans l’invite de commandes, tapez powercfg.exe /hibernate off, puis appuyez sur Entrée.
Tapez exit, puis appuyez sur Entrée pour fermer la fenêtre d’invite de commandes.

Hors ligne

#11 Le 06/11/2022, à 11:14

Tchae7

Re : Installation double boot sur SSD vierge

Bonjour,

suivant vos conseils

1) j'ai commencé par créer une table de partition GPT avec GParted.
2) J'ai installé windows sur une partition de 100 Go
3) J'ai créé un disque de 750 Go en NTFS avec l'outil de gestion des disques.
4) j'ai rebooté sur la clef live usb Ubuntu (difficile, même avec la veille prolongée désactivée ça ne fonctionne pas, j'ai bidouillé dans le bios et il a accepté de booter sur la clef après que je sois passé de UEFI à Legacy, hier c'est exactement le contraire qui s'est passé, il accepté de booter sur la clef seulement après que je sois passé de Legacy à UEFI. Qq chose m'échappe...)
5) J'ai demandé de formater/partitionner les 75Go restant de libres (sous GParted) en ext4 avec mounting point /
6) Et lorsque je demande d'installer Ubuntu sur cette dernière partion j'obtiens le message "d'"erreur" suivant:

The partition table format in use on your disks normally requires you to create a separate partition for boot loader code. This partition should be marked for use as a "Reserved BIOS boot area" and should be at least 1 MB in size. Note that this is not the same as a partition mounted on /boot

Dois-je continuer ?

Dernière modification par Tchae7 (Le 06/11/2022, à 11:16)

Hors ligne

#12 Le 06/11/2022, à 11:23

geole

Re : Installation double boot sur SSD vierge

Normalement , tu as installé windows en EFI
Si tu continues en LEGACY, windows ne sera pas détecté. De plus en LEGACY il faut une nouvelle partition  BIOS-GRUB de 2 Mo

Mon conseil.
Remets le bios  en EFI , Lance windows, et refabrique ta clé avec un outil capable de  gérer aussi  EFI tel que ventoy

Hors ligne

#13 Le 06/11/2022, à 11:28

Tchae7

Re : Installation double boot sur SSD vierge

Ok neutral

Mais est ce que je peux garder la partition ext4 que je viens de créer ou il vaut mieux l'effacer ?

Dernière modification par Tchae7 (Le 06/11/2022, à 11:29)

Hors ligne

#14 Le 06/11/2022, à 12:31

Tchae7

Re : Installation double boot sur SSD vierge

J'ai créé une clef Ubuntu 22.04avec Ventoy mais même constat, si je suis en UEFI il démarre windows.
En Legacy il boot sur Ventoy et je peux essayer ou installer Ubuntu

Hors ligne

#15 Le 06/11/2022, à 12:39

geole

Re : Installation double boot sur SSD vierge

Pour windows as-tu déactivé l' hibernation https://learn.microsoft.com/en-us/troub … ibernation

powercfg  /hibernate off

Tu peux conserver la partition ext4 créée. Il te suffira de la choisir au lieu d'un espace libre

Hors ligne

#16 Le 06/11/2022, à 12:46

Tchae7

Re : Installation double boot sur SSD vierge

Oui je l'ai bien désactivée, je recommence pour être sur (y a t il un moyen de vérifier ?)

Pour la création avec ventoy j'ai laissé les options par défaut (Mbr...) et j'i fait un copier coller de l'iso Ubuntu 22.04 (et ça fonctionne bien en Legacy)


EDIT : j'ai (re)désactivé hibernate et il continue à lancer windows en UEFI et à booter sur la claf en Legacy

Dernière modification par Tchae7 (Le 06/11/2022, à 12:51)

Hors ligne

#17 Le 06/11/2022, à 13:46

geole

Re : Installation double boot sur SSD vierge

Peux-tu faire des photos de ton bios et les poster dans un  site dédié
Dans quoi as-tu fait un copier/coller de l'ISO?

Dernière modification par geole (Le 06/11/2022, à 13:49)

Hors ligne

#18 Le 06/11/2022, à 20:04

Tchae7

Re : Installation double boot sur SSD vierge

J'ai copier / coller l'iso sur la clef où j'ai installé Ventoy

Le Bios :
https://ibb.co/LhrrGCc
https://ibb.co/HzL7Y0b
https://ibb.co/gFb2FN1
https://ibb.co/brM366J
Démarrage sur la clef en Legacy :
https://ibb.co/dMzbyDr

Hors ligne

#19 Le 06/11/2022, à 21:09

geole

Re : Installation double boot sur SSD vierge

Sur le second écran, il y a écrit " usb legacy  ENABLE"
Peux-tu le passer en "disable'.

Dernière modification par geole (Le 06/11/2022, à 21:15)

Hors ligne

#20 Le 06/11/2022, à 21:22

Tchae7

Re : Installation double boot sur SSD vierge

Oui je peux le passer en disable mais je laisse Legacy support dans Boot ?

EDIT : Quoi qu'il en soit il ne veut plus booter sur la clef maintenant.

Dernière modification par Tchae7 (Le 06/11/2022, à 21:23)

Hors ligne

#21 Le 06/11/2022, à 21:27

geole

Re : Installation double boot sur SSD vierge

Alors, autre solution, remettre le legacy,
Recommencer depuis tout le début.
Mais au lieu de dire à gparted de fabriquer une table de partition GPT, tu diras ms-dos

Hors ligne

#22 Le 07/11/2022, à 07:20

malbo

Re : Installation double boot sur SSD vierge

Bonjour,
Au démarrage de l'ordi, la clé USB étant connectée, presse la touche F12 pour aller dans le Boot Menu. En principe, tu devrais trouver une ligne qui propose ta clé USB avec la mention "EFI" en tête (du genre "EFI USB Device") qui doit être sélectionnée et validée par la touche Entrée pour permettre de démarrer en mode UEFI sur cette clé. Si ce n'est pas le cas (si tu ne trouves pas cette ligne "EFI") , prends un photo de ce Boot Menu et donne le lien dans ta réponse afin qu'on puisse voir à quoi ça ressemble.

EDIT : pour savoir dans quel mode est démarré une session live, tu peux utiliser la commande proposée dans le paragraphe 2.3 Vérifier si l'ordinateur démarre en mode EFI sur le disque dur (ou sur le support Live)
C'est à utiliser si tu crois avoir réussi à démarrer en EFI sur ta clé USB

Dernière modification par malbo (Le 07/11/2022, à 07:31)

Hors ligne

#23 Le 07/11/2022, à 08:30

iznobe

Re : Installation double boot sur SSD vierge

Bonjour , le probleme est là : https://imgbb.com/brM366J rien n' est correctement configuré pour demarrer en EFI dans le demarrage ...

partout ou il y a ecrit : " LEGACY " tu changes pour mettre EFI . tu sauvegardes et tu redemarres , et ca partira en EFI .
si tu ne peux mettre EFI a la place , met un truc qui ne contient pas le mot LEGACY .

Dernière modification par iznobe (Le 07/11/2022, à 08:32)


retour utilisable de commande
MSI Z490A-pro , i7 10700 , 32 GB RAM .

En ligne

#24 Le 07/11/2022, à 15:31

Tchae7

Re : Installation double boot sur SSD vierge

@iznobe

Je ne comprends pas ta réponse, oui je suis en Legacy dans le boot puisque en UEFI ça ne boot pas sur la clef mais sur windows.
J'essayerai de vous envoyer des photos des différentes options de cette page ce soir, mais (pour l'instant ?) je n'ai trouvé que UEFI ou Legacy
Si je suis en UEFI --> il boot sur windows
Si je suis en Legacy --> il boot sur la clef

Hors ligne

#25 Le 07/11/2022, à 20:10

Tchae7

Re : Installation double boot sur SSD vierge

@ malbo
Il semble que F12 me permet de résoudre ce problème. (je ne connaissais pas, merci !)
Le démarrage se fait en deux temps, je dois choisir le dispositif de démarrage dans le menu de F12 (et je suis maintenant en UEFI sur la page boot du BIOS).

Espérons que ça va fonctionner maintenant...

Au niveau des options de Ventoy ; je boot en normal mode ou en grub mode ?

Hors ligne